蒼青のミラージュ是Moefantasy在2018年开始运营的战舰少女R外传游戏。
其在很多地方超越的本家,可以说是制作精良的一款舰娘游戏。
其配音也能传神的反映游戏角色的性格。这里我就来写一下如何提取游戏内的音频。

操作简述

1.打包提取/android/data/com.moefantasy.neoforce下的文件
2.发现存放声音文件的目录在../flies/Sound
3.文件的格式是.awb和.acb 使用VGMToolbox 选择EXtraction Tools-Common Archives-CRI/AWB Archive 把.awb和.acb拖入解码
4.得到了.hca文件 使用HCA Decoder解码
使用方法 把文件拖到hca.exe上
备注:角色的语音存放在../files/Sound/BattleVoice ConversationVoice和Voice下


实际操作

首先我很自然的找到了蒼青的安装包,打开之后却并没有发现什么资源文件。看样子应该都存在数据里了。
Android系统APP的数据基本都存在/android/data下
找了一圈 发现了com.moefantasy.neoforce文件夹 与包名一致。

NFC)00Y)~T8E5PFB~UWMMVY.png

可以看到 文件结构如下,而这么明显的sound文件夹里的文件就是我们此次的目标了。
顺带提一下,贴图文件被保存在/unity cache/下的MZHDXQY%8GLM1E_ATTY~A.png

如果只是提取声音的话,只拷贝soud文件夹就行。
soud文件夹下有许多.awb和.acb文件。很明显,这就是那些音频文件了。
对于这种文件,我们使用VGMToolbox
%$D0606W07FMZJ6[HG6CMPI.png
得到了.hca文件 然后使用HCA Decoder解密
9_6R6[_6$UXX2`PHX2QP%ZW.png
这里使用了NO.107 昆西的语音文件
HCA Decoder就会自动把.hca文件解码成.wav文件

另外,提取部分未加密的贴图方法见

通过这个方法,可以直接获得游戏中(指蒼青幻影)出现的任何音频。希望这篇文章能帮助到各位同人作者。